Four more medals for British wrestlers in Spain

GREAT Britain have continued their excellent recent form by collecting four medals at the Spanish Grand Prix in Madrid.

Manchester's Krasimir Krastanov took gold in the 55kg category with a points victory over Germany's Tim Schleicher to add to the bronze medal he won last month in Sardinia.

Leon Rattigan, who also collected bronze last month, repeated the trick in the 96kg category in Spain, while Mohammadali Haghidoust also picked up bronze in the 74kg division.

"It was another terrific performance from our wrestlers, and to bring home four medals from a prestigious European tournament is a great result," said GB performance director Shaun Morley.

In the women's ranks, Jayne Clayson collected Great Britain's third bronze in the 55kg category.
